What dimensions commercial dryer do I want for my laundry loads?
Begin with this sensible rule:
In case you have a 10kg washer, match it having a twelve–15kg dryer
Should you run a 20kg washer, check out a 24–30kg dryer
For multiple washers, calculate peak-hour throughput, not day by day average
Why larger sized? For the reason that moist linen expands and needs House for airflow. Industrial dryers rely on air movement to get rid of moisture effectively.
The U.S. Department of Electricity notes that airflow and proper loading substantially influence dryer performance and performance, especially in substantial-volume environments (Vitality.gov – Clothes Dryers).
In realistic phrases: stuffing a 20kg damp load right into a 20kg dryer minimizes airflow. Dry moments improve. Electricity utilization climbs. Linen suffers.

How can I compute peak laundry demand?
Most operators underestimate this.
Inquire:
The quantity of loads run through your busiest two-hour window?
Exactly what is the common moisture retention soon after spin?
Are you presently drying hefty objects like towels or light-weight clothes?
Do customers count on very same-hour turnaround?
For example:
When you procedure 8 x 15kg loads in between 7am and 9am, your dryers should deal with 120kg of wet linen within that window. If Each and every drying cycle will take 40 minutes, you’ll have to have more than enough ability to stop stacking delays.
This is when throughput per hour issues a lot more than drum measurement on your own.

How about airflow, heat output and extraction velocity?
Capability is just one variable.
A appropriately sized commercial industrial dryer will have to equilibrium:
Drum volume (litres)
Airflow (CFM)
Heat enter (MJ/h or BTU/h)
Washer extraction velocity
Higher-speed extract washers (350–four hundred G-force) take away more drinking water before drying. That cuts down drying time by up to twenty–30%. Which suggests you might not want just as much dryer capability as you believe.
That is why pairing equipment issues. It’s also why skilled operators review The complete method, not simply one machine.

A useful sizing components you can use
Though specific calculations depend upon manufacturer and design, here’s an easy manual:
Overall Washer Capacity × one.twenty five = Suggested Dryer Capability
Illustration:
15kg washer × 1.25 you could check here = 18.75kg
Round as many as a 20kg professional dryer.
This buffer permits right airflow with out overcapitalising.
FAQ: Industrial Industrial Dryer Sizing
Can I match dryer dimensions exactly to washer dimension?
It is possible to, but performance might drop. Soaked textiles require more space for airflow. A twenty–25% larger dryer improves efficiency.
Does linen sort have an effect on dryer sizing?
Indeed. Towels and bedding maintain much more humidity than light-weight clothes. Hospitality operations frequently require a bit higher dryer potential.
The amount of dryers per washer should really I set up?
In well balanced systems, full dryer capacity need to exceed complete washer ability by 20–50%, based on peak demand from customers and extraction speed.
